DRDO carries out its research and development work through a distributed network of specialised laboratories and establishments, each focused on a particular technology domain. Rather than a single campus, the organisation operates from cities across India, allowing individual laboratories to build deep expertise while feeding designs into a common weapons-development pipeline for the armed forces. The network has grown steadily since 1958, when DRDO began with only a handful of laboratories inherited from the Defence Science Organisation and the Indian Army's technical development units.

Key facts

  • Network size: around fifty laboratories and establishments, organised into technology clusters such as missiles, aeronautics, armaments, electronics, naval systems, life sciences and materials
  • Major missile hubs: Defence Research and Development Laboratory (DRDL) and Research Centre Imarat (RCI), both in Hyderabad
  • Major aeronautics hubs: Aeronautical Development Establishment (ADE) and Aeronautical Development Agency (ADA), both in Bengaluru
  • Major electronics hubs: Electronics and Radar Development Establishment (LRDE), Bengaluru, and Defence Electronics Application Laboratory (DEAL), Dehradun
  • Combat vehicles and propellants: Combat Vehicles Research and Development Establishment (CVRDE), Chennai/Avadi; Gas Turbine Research Establishment (GTRE), Bengaluru; High Energy Materials Research Laboratory (HEMRL), Pune
  • Newer additions: five DRDO Young Scientists Laboratories (DYSLs), launched in 2021 to work on emerging technologies such as artificial intelligence, quantum technology, cognitive technologies, asymmetric technologies and smart materials

Missile and strategic systems laboratories

DRDL is the lead laboratory for missile design and integration, responsible for the Agni and Prithvi families among other strategic systems, while the adjoining RCI specialises in missile guidance, avionics and seeker technology. A third Hyderabad establishment, the Advanced Systems Laboratory, handles propulsion and airframe structures for long-range missiles. Together, these laboratories form the backbone of India's ballistic and cruise missile programmes, and also support the BrahMos Aerospace joint venture with Russia on propulsion and guidance technology.

Aeronautics and electronics laboratories

ADA, formed specifically to steer the Tejas Light Combat Aircraft programme, works alongside ADE, which develops unmanned aerial vehicles, flight control systems and aeronautical structures. LRDE designs ground, airborne and naval radars, including the Rohini and Rajendra series and the indigenous Uttam active electronically scanned array radar developed for Tejas, while DEAL in Dehradun focuses on electronic warfare and tactical communication systems.

Combat vehicles, naval and materials laboratories

CVRDE designed the Arjun main battle tank and continues to develop armoured platforms, working alongside GTRE, which develops gas turbine aero-engines, including the indigenous Kaveri engine programme, and the Vehicles Research and Development Establishment in Ahmednagar, which works on wheeled and tracked military vehicles. On the naval side, the Naval Physical and Oceanographic Laboratory in Kochi develops sonar and underwater sensor systems, while HEMRL in Pune develops propellants, explosives and pyrotechnics used across missiles, ammunition and rocket systems.

Life sciences and emerging technology

A separate cluster of laboratories, including the Institute of Nuclear Medicine and Allied Sciences and the Defence Institute of Physiology and Allied Sciences, both in Delhi, works on soldier health, high-altitude physiology, combat rations and protective equipment. The five DRDO Young Scientists Laboratories, spread across several Indian cities, were created to bring younger scientists into frontier fields not covered by the legacy laboratory network.

Each laboratory typically partners with academic institutions, defence public sector units and, increasingly, private industry to move a design from prototype to fielded system, with DRDO Headquarters in New Delhi coordinating budgets, programme reviews and technology transfer across the network.
